亲!您好,很高兴为您解答。亲-bash+src/redis-server: 没有那个文件 如下:你确认你脚本第一行写的是#!/bin/bash,从你的出错信息中看,你写的好像是bin/bash,少个/。有种方法可以解决,你可以从其他地方copy一个shell脚本到你需要的目录下,然后vi进去把内容删除,重新把你写的脚本内容粘贴进去...
### ### sentinel 配置说明 ### #Sentinel实例的端口号 port 26379 #Sentinel 实例的目录 dir /tmp #日志文件 logfile /var/log/redis/redis-server.log #后台执行 daemonize yes#3.2里的参数,是否开启保护模式,默认开启。要是配置里没有指定bind和密码。开启该参数后,redis只会本地进行访问,拒绝外部访问。...
-v /docker/redis/data:/data:映射数据目录 redis-server /etc/redis/redis.conf:指定配置文件启动redis-server进程 --appendonly yes:开启数据持久化
其中,<文件路径>是Redis压缩文件的路径,<解压路径>是解压后文件的存储路径。 步骤4:检查解压结果 小白需要检查解压后的文件中是否包含redis-server可执行文件。可以通过以下命令来查找: ls<解压路径> 1. 如果输出中包含redis-server文件,则表示解压有误。如果找不到该文件,则表示解压成功。 4. 代码示例 解压命令示...
由于安装版的Redis服务自启动,是直接通过redis-server.exe启动的,但是,启动时并没有加载Redis的配置文件(redis.windows.conf),导致redis 中bind配置和密码设置不生效。 Redis自启动导致的常见的问题有: 1、在CMD命令加载配置文件(redis.windows.conf)进行启动是不成功的。提示如下: ...
配置文件路径不正确:检查配置文件的路径是否正确,确保指定了正确的文件路径。 配置文件格式错误:检查配置文件的语法是否正确,确保配置文件格式正确,没有语法错误或拼写错误。可以通过在命令行中输入 redis-server –test <配置文件路径> 来测试配置文件是否有错误。
Redis的Server实例启动是从server.c这个文件的main开始执行的 int main(int argc, char **argv) { struct timeval tv; int j; char config_from_stdin = 0; // 删除了代码中的#ifdef // 设置时区 setlocale(LC_COLLATE,""); tzset(); /* Populates 'timezone' global. */ ...
3、配置文件第38行~第44行,MODULES内容如下: ### MODULES ### # 启动时加载模块。如果服务器无法加载模块,它将中止。可以使用多个loadmodule指令。 # Load modules at startup. If the server is not able to load modules # it will abort. It is possible to use multiple loadmodule directives. # #...
dir /new/path/to/redis 保存并退出编辑器: 在vim编辑器中按下“Esc”键退出编辑模式,然后输入“:wq”命令保存修改并退出。 启动Redis实例: 修改完Redis配置文件路径后,使用以下命令启动Redis实例: redis-server /path/to/redis.conf 验证修改是否生效: